  • if reseller quits program, where do customers go

    I'm sure there is a smooth transition for customers of a reseller who quits, to some "default" reseller or account. For instance, any GoDaddy reseller that quits, their customers automatically default over to Domains Priced Right, a default reseller property OWNED by Godaddy. Just curious how RSP handles this.

    Larry,

    You can just quit and RSP assume the clients

    You can let your account "coast" on a default free storefront and url let rsp handle support (still collect commissions this way and still possibly collect new customers by existing customer referrals)

    You can migrate your accounts to another reseller platform.

    That is how I understand this works...... may be more options but I dont know them.....

        Hello.

        We do have our own Free Reseller Account that can be used in such cases.

        The most important is that the clients should not suffer any downtimes or service interruptions.

        We had Resellers quit, changing business and etc. and this was how we have handled it.

        Just switching the owner of the Accounts to our Reseller Account.

        In some cases update of the NameServers is need (if the Reseller had DNS Cluster Package).
